Albert Sidney Ashworth, 78, of Rosenberg, passed away Tuesday, Dec. 19, 2006 at OakBend Medical Center. He was born May 29, 1928 in Village Mills, Texas. He was a member of Masonic Lodge No. 881, served in the U.S. Navy and the Korean War, was a member of the VFW and American Legion, and also the First Baptist Church of Rosenberg.
He was preceded in death by his parents, A.S. Ashworth Sr. and Minnie Birdwell Ashworth; and sister, Billie Jean Mooman.
He is survived by his wife, Janet DeShazo Ashworth; daughters: Kelly Ashworth, Robin Schwenke and husband, Mark, and Ginger Tucker and husband, Tommy; and two granddaughters, Miranda and Ashley Tucker.
